Abstract

PURPOSE: To prevent casting cracks by suppressing occurrences of strains during the course of cooling, by casting the molten metal of antiferromagnetic chromium invar alloy in a ceramic mold in an inert gaseous atmosphere and cooling it slowly after it is maintained at a specified temperature.
CONSTITUTION: The antiferromagnetic chromium invar alloy is melted in an inert gaseous atmosphere by using an induction furnace. This molten metal is poured into a ceramic mold and casted and it is red heated by maintaining it for ≥30min in the range defined by 1,300°CW1,100°C temperature. The molten metal is cooled slowly at ≤5°C/min cooling rate in the range defined by 1,000°CW400°C temperature so that no temperature difference is generated substantially between the surface and the central part of ingot. In this way, a sound ingot is manufactured in a industrial scale without generating minute cracks in the inside of the ingot.
